Quick answers for fast planning

How do I switch the Camping Bakkum website to English or German?

Use the language links in the header or go directly to:

Does Camping Bakkum support German-speaking families with on-site materials?

Yes. The Kennemer Duincampings holiday Doeboek is sold at reception for €10 in Dutch and German.

How close is the beach to Camping Bakkum?

The campsite is set in the dunes right beside the coast; the beach is an easy walk from pitches and accommodations.

Is there Wi-Fi on the campsite?

Yes. Wi-Fi is available for guests.

Where is the minigolf course, and how do I book a slot?

The 15-hole minigolf course lies between the Ontmoetingsplein and De Pan (the open-air theatre). Book a time slot and hire clubs at the reception.

What are the check-in and check-out times?

Check-in begins at 2:00 PM. Check-out is before 12:00 PM.

How do I reserve sports facilities like padel, tennis, or the gym?

Guests can reserve time slots for the tennis court, padel court, and gym via the reception.

Where can I find the recreation program and events?

The first part of the seasonal recreation program and upcoming events are published in the online agenda on the website, including activities in De Pan.

Are pets allowed at Camping Bakkum?

No. Dogs and other pets are not permitted. Guests who wish to bring a dog can reserve at affiliated Camping Geversduin in Castricum.
